During the last week, Allegheny County reported a total of 9 crime cases. These cases included 2 shootings, 2 arrests, and 2 assaults, which were the most recurring crimes, each accounting for approximately 22% of the total crimes. The remaining 33% was made up of a theft case, a suspicious situation, and an ‘other’ category crime, which involved a missing 65-year-old person. The crime occurrences were spread throughout the week, with the earliest reported case being a theft on February 10th at 8:18 AM, and the latest reported case being a shooting on February 15th at 1:52 AM.
